Large files (above 100MB) not being indexed!

X1 Search 8 will index up to 2MB of total text of any given document.

The maximum file size setting determines the total size of files that X1 will attempt to index. This is meant to capture documents that may have other elements such as formatting and images that can drive up the total size of a file. Word documents are a perfect example of file sizes being larger than immediately makes sense for the amount of text they contain.

2MB of text is a lot of text, and we've found this maximum to be more than sufficient for a typical business user's needs.

Yes, you may have documents that have more than 2MB of text, but these generally fall out of the standard business productivity use-case.

You could try splitting up your documents so they can be indexed, but this may be an onerous task depending on the size, formatting, and nature of the document.
